Voice of London have picked out the cities major airports and found you the winners.<\/h4>\n<p>Thousands of people responded to a <em>Which? <\/em>survey after the summer, rating their airport experiences across the UK. Based on overall satisfaction, customers gave London Luton a hard-hitting score of 29%, crowning it the worst airport in the country. Holiday-goers were left short of relaxing as they experienced hectic bag drops, overcrowding and \u201cchaos\u201d at customs.<\/p>\n<p>London has more airports than any other major city, so how do you pick where to fly?
